During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of Louisiana at Monroe handed out 37 bachelor's degrees in other health professions and related clinical sciences. This is a decrease of 16% over the previous year when 44 degrees were handed out.

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the other health professions and related clinical sciences majors at University of Louisiana at Monroe.

For the most recent academic year available, 3% of other health professions and related clinical sciences bachelor's degrees went to men and 97% went to women.

The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at ULM are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 59% of students f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Louisiana at Monroe with a bachelor's in other health professions and related clinical sciences.

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 9
Hispanic or Latino 0
White 22
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 6
